Lifespan and operational life in Palsana
One of the most critical factors when choosing an energy storage solution for your Palsana property is its expected lifespan. The Hot-Dry climate of Palsana, with its high ambient temperatures, can impact battery performance and longevity. Understanding how each technology fares under typical operating conditions is essential for long-term planning and return on investment.
- Lithium: Typically offers a significantly longer operational life, often exceeding 10 years or 3000-6000 charge/discharge cycles. This extended lifespan translates to fewer replacements and a lower total cost of ownership over time for Palsana users.
- Lead-acid: Generally provides a shorter lifespan, usually 3-5 years or 500-1500 cycles. Factors like deep discharges and high temperatures, common in Palsana, can further reduce their effective life, necessitating more frequent replacements.
Maintenance: sealed vs water-topping for Palsana
Maintenance requirements directly influence the convenience and ongoing cost of an energy storage system. For busy homeowners and business operators in Palsana, a low-maintenance solution is often preferred. The design differences between lithium and lead-acid batteries lead to vastly different upkeep demands, impacting user experience and operational efficiency.
- Lithium: These batteries are inherently maintenance-free. Their sealed design means there's no need for periodic water topping or checking electrolyte levels, making them a 'set and forget' solution. This simplifies ownership for Palsana residents and businesses, reducing time and labour costs.
- Lead-acid: Often requires regular maintenance, particularly for flooded (tubular) variants. This includes periodically checking and topping up distilled water levels, cleaning terminals, and ensuring adequate ventilation. Neglecting these tasks can shorten the battery's life and performance, adding to the operational burden in Palsana.
Weight, footprint and installation in Palsana properties
The physical characteristics of an energy storage system, including its weight and footprint, are important considerations for installation, especially in urban environments like Palsana where space can be at a premium. Modern design trends favour compact and aesthetically integrated solutions, which impacts where and how a system can be deployed.
- Lithium: Known for their high energy density, lithium batteries are significantly lighter and more compact than lead-acid equivalents for the same power output. This allows for wall-mounted installations, freeing up floor space and offering greater flexibility in placement within Palsana homes or commercial premises.
- Lead-acid: These batteries are considerably heavier and bulkier, typically requiring floor-standing installations. Their larger footprint often necessitates dedicated battery rooms or outdoor enclosures, which can be a challenge for space-constrained properties in Palsana.
Charge speed, depth of discharge, and reliability under Hot-Dry conditions
Performance during power outages and efficiency in recharging are vital for any backup system. Palsana's typical Hot-Dry climate zone, coupled with Moderate (1000-2000 mm/yr) monsoon intensity, demands robust performance. Battery technologies differ significantly in how quickly they can recharge and how much of their stored energy can be safely utilised, impacting overall reliability.
- Lithium: Offers faster charging capabilities, often reaching full capacity in a few hours. They can also be safely discharged to 80-90% of their capacity without significant impact on lifespan. Their thermal management systems ensure reliable operation even in Palsana's high ambient temperatures.
- Lead-acid: Charges at a slower rate, requiring longer grid availability to fully recharge. They are generally recommended for discharge only up to 50% of their capacity to preserve lifespan. Deep discharges beyond this can severely degrade performance, and high temperatures can accelerate this degradation.
Safety, environmental considerations and the PuREPower path for Palsana
Beyond performance, safety and environmental impact are increasingly important factors for Palsana consumers. Modern energy solutions must address these concerns comprehensively. While both technologies have safety standards, their fundamental designs lead to different considerations regarding their operational safety and end-of-life disposal. - Lithium: Integrated lithium systems, like PuREPower, are engineered with advanced safety management systems to prevent overcharging, over-discharging, and overheating. Their sealed nature eliminates the risk of acid spills, and they contain no heavy metals like lead.
- Lead-acid: Contains corrosive sulfuric acid, posing a risk of spills or leaks if damaged. While recyclable, improper disposal can lead to environmental contamination. Ventilation is also critical to manage hydrogen gas emissions during charging.
